Marcin Owsiany, le Sat 23 Jun 2012 10:53:45 +0100, a écrit : > Can someone explain what this message actually means? How is > "inactivity" determined? Is the build really idling, or just taking that > long?
It means the build didn't produce any output during that time. > The build times on other architectures were 2-5 minutes (10-13 on arm*). > > Is there a way to bump this threshold, to see if giving it more time > helps? Well, I don't think it will help. 3 hours is already very long, compared to even arm figures. It most probably just hangs. You could give it a try on the exodar.debian.net porter machine.
